Output ec848284767ffac60042e62f166af892c20c8da12dceb54809aa61b2e082cfa5:0

value
561316
script pubkey
OP_0 OP_PUSHBYTES_20 20ce0abba058da32141f05ad7dab0fde1ef0b220
address
bc1qyr8q4waqtrdry9qlqkkhm2c0mc00pv3qtc2c7p
transaction
ec848284767ffac60042e62f166af892c20c8da12dceb54809aa61b2e082cfa5
confirmations
64803
spent
true